Jennic 6LoWPAN Networking Stack for Embedded Devices

Jennic's 6LoWPAN networking stack enables a single-chipimplementation for next-generation low-power wireless IP inembedded devices. By extending the widely understood IP protocolinto the low power wireless domain, applications may leverageexisting IP infrastructure and knowledge base, reducing developmentcosts and time to market. The Jennic 6LoWPAN stack is sampling now,with general availability of a 6LoWPAN evaluation kit planned forthis quarter.

Based on the familiar IEEE802.15.4 standard as used by ZigBee,Jennic's 6LoWPAN networking stack runs on their feature-rich JN5139wireless microcontroller, which integrates a 2.4GHz IEEE802.15.4transceiver and a 32-bit processor core, with sufficient memoryremaining to run application software. The Jennic 6LoWPAN stacksupports simple star networks, or can be run on top of the stableand field-proven JenNet stack that provides self-healing clustertree networking capability, with automatic route formation andrepair. The power consumption of 6LoWPAN is a fraction of Wi-Fi,meaning that products such as heating controls, security sensors,patient monitoring equipment, process controllers and sensors, canbe IP-enabled with multi-year battery life expectancy.
Jennic's 6LoWPAN stack runs on their JN5139 32-bit wirelessmicrocontroller and wireless modules. The competitively pricedmicrocontroller features large memory resources of 192kBytes of ROMand 96kBytes of RAM for the IEEE802.15.4 MAC; 6LoWPAN and JenNetstacks; and application software. It also integrates UARTs, SPI and2-wire serial (I2C) interfaces, general purpose I/O (GPIO), timers,a 12-bit ADC, DAC and comparators, whilst maintaining powerconsumption below 5uA in low-power sleep mode. The integrated2.4GHz, IEEE802.15.4-based transceiver supports a 100dB link forcommunication over 30-50m distances indoors as well as secure128-bit AES encryption. As the first single-chip implementation for6LoWPAN, the Jennic solution allows engineers to create compact,cost-effective systems that leverage IP communications to enhancefunctionality whilst reducing development costs.
